Ryzen hat keine 16MB L3-Cache ;-)

Es liefen nur die notwendigen Systemprozesse im Hintergrund. Allerdings waren Stromsparmechanismen in Kraft, die das Ergebnis durchaus verfälscht haben können. Zwar war das Profil "Höchstleistung" als Energiesparplan ausgewählt, aber ich habe das Profil so angepasst, dass Cool'n'Quiet nicht außer Kraft gesetzt wird. Jedenfalls fiel das Ergebnis inkonsistent und nicht reproduzierbar aus. Die zwei Durchläufe waren eine Auswahl.
Könnte es sein, dass der Windows-Scheduler das Programm während der Messung zwischen den Kernen hin- und herschiebt? Dann müsste man mit fester Affinität konsistente Messwerte bekommen.
 
Könnte es sein, dass der Windows-Scheduler das Programm während der Messung zwischen den Kernen hin- und herschiebt? Dann müsste man mit fester Affinität konsistente Messwerte bekommen.
Zwischen gerade und ungerade sollte es kein Problem sein, innerhalb eines Modul: (0+1) (2+3) (4+5) (6+7).
Modul übergreifend wird es schon wieder komplexer.

Memory Areas auswählen: http://abload.de/img/siv64x_mem_areas_wher98slz.jpg
Execute: http://abload.de/img/siv64x_mem_areas_exec4qs7o.jpg
 
Zurück
Oben Unten